Summary
The ASEEES First Book Subvention Program, established by the Association for Slavic, East European, and Eurasian Studies (ASEEES), provides financial support up to $2500 for first-time authors' book projects. This initiative encourages scholarly contributions in Slavic, East European, and Eurasian Studies by covering costs such as editing, design, and printing. Applications are accepted from publishers, emphasizing the importance of peer-reviewed manuscripts that are nearing publication.Overview
Association for Slavic, East European, and Eurasian Studies Established in 1948, the Association for Slavic, East European, and Eurasian Studies (ASEEES) – a nonprofit, non-political, scholarly society – is the leading international organization dedicated to the advancement of knowledge about Central Asia, the Caucasus, Russia, and Eastern Europe in regional and global contexts. ASEEES First Book Subvention Program The ASEEES First Book Subvention Program provides multiple awards of up to $2500 for subvention of books by first-time authors on a biannual basis. Funds can be used for copy editing, design/composition/typesetting, e-book conversion, image preparation, printing, and other direct costs. Applications are invited from all disciplines. Applications should be submitted by publishers only—not by authors.Eligibility

Authors must be regular or student members of ASEEES for the year of the application submission plus at least one prior year.Subventions will only be awarded for individually authored first books.An applicant who has already published an edited collection will not be disqualified.Manuscripts must be in English and, in the view of the selection committee, make a substantial scholarly contribution to Slavic, East European, and/or Eurasian Studies. English translations of first books published initially in another language will be considered on a case-by-case basis. The Press must agree to acknowledge subvention support from ASEEES in the front matter of the book, and to provide ASEEES with a copy of the finished work upon publication. The acknowledgement to ASEEES should read as follows: “Publication of this book was made possible, in part, by a grant from the First Book Subvention Program of the Association for Slavic, East European, and Eurasian Studies.” The press must agree to submit a brief itemized report on how subvention funds were spent within two months of the book’s publication date. Applicants must actively seek funding from additional sources, including the author’s home institution; ASEEES prefers to split subvention costs with other institutions whenever possible. A press may submit no more than 2 applications per cycle (including resubmissions).Applications should be made for manuscripts that have already been contracted and peer reviewed in full, and are at or nearing the production stage.
